components/tomcat/patches/build.xml.patch
branchs11-update
changeset 2602 5caab247ea3d
parent 2474 c9068cb41676
child 4089 1788e52b3086
equal deleted inserted replaced
2601:af823e6595c2 2602:5caab247ea3d
     1 --- apache-tomcat-6.0.36-src/build.xml	Tue Oct 16 01:05:51 2012
     1 --- apache-tomcat-6.0.36-src/build.xml
     2 +++ apache-tomcat-6.0.36-src/build.xml	Thu Dec  6 04:01:54 2012
     2 +++ apache-tomcat-6.0.36-src/build.xml
     3 @@ -487,13 +487,6 @@
     3 @@ -487,13 +487,6 @@
     4  
     4  
     5    <target name="deploy" depends="build-only,build-docs,warn.dbcp">
     5    <target name="deploy" depends="build-only,build-docs,warn.dbcp">
     6  
     6  
     7 -    <copy tofile="${tomcat.build}/bin/tomcat-native.tar.gz"
     7 -    <copy tofile="${tomcat.build}/bin/tomcat-native.tar.gz"
    54 -    </antcall>
    54 -    </antcall>
    55 -
    55 -
    56      <!-- Build Tomcat DBCP bundle -->
    56      <!-- Build Tomcat DBCP bundle -->
    57      <antcall target="downloadgz-2">
    57      <antcall target="downloadgz-2">
    58        <param name="sourcefile.1" value="${commons-pool-src.loc.1}"/>
    58        <param name="sourcefile.1" value="${commons-pool-src.loc.1}"/>
    59 @@ -836,15 +794,9 @@
    59 @@ -823,6 +781,11 @@
       
    60        <param name="sourcefile.2" value="${commons-dbcp-src.loc.2}"/>
       
    61        <param name="destfile" value="${commons-dbcp.home}/build.xml" />
       
    62      </antcall>
       
    63 +    <!-- We need to patch DBCP so it can be built with JDK 1.7. -->
       
    64 +    <exec executable="sh">
       
    65 +      <arg value="-c" />
       
    66 +      <arg value="cat ../../jdbc41.patch | gpatch -d ${commons-dbcp.home} -p0" />
       
    67 +    </exec>
       
    68      <mkdir dir="${tomcat-dbcp.home}"/>
       
    69      <antcall target="build-tomcat-dbcp">
       
    70        <param name="basedir" value="${tomcat-dbcp.home}" />
       
    71 @@ -836,15 +799,9 @@
    60        <param name="destdir" value="${jdt.home}"/>
    72        <param name="destdir" value="${jdt.home}"/>
    61      </antcall>
    73      </antcall>
    62  
    74  
    63 -    <antcall target="downloadzip">
    75 -    <antcall target="downloadzip">
    64 -      <param name="sourcefile" value="${nsis.loc}"/>
    76 -      <param name="sourcefile" value="${nsis.loc}"/>